Развертывание Django с Gunicorn ¶
Gunicorn («Зеленый единорог») - это чистый Python WSGI-сервер для UNIX. Он не имеет зависимостей и может быть установлен вместе с ним pip
.
Установка Gunicorn ¶
Установите gunicorn, запустив . Для получения дополнительной информации см. Документацию Gunicorn .python -m pip install gunicorn
Django в Gunicorn как универсальное приложение WSGI ¶
Когда Gunicorn установлен, gunicorn
доступна команда для запуска серверного процесса Gunicorn. Самый простой вызов gunicorn - передать ему местоположение модуля, содержащего именованный объект приложения WSGI application
, который для типичного проекта Django будет выглядеть так:
gunicorn myproject.wsgi
Это запустит процесс, использующий прослушивающий поток . Ваш проект должен находиться на пути Python; Самый простой способ убедиться - запустить эту команду в том же каталоге, что и ваш файл .127.0.0.1: 8000
manage.py
Дополнительную информацию см. В документации по развертыванию Gunicorn.